About

Pathward Financial, Inc. operates as the bank holding company for Pathward, National Association that provides various banking products and services in the United States. It operates through three segments: Consumer, Commercial, and Corporate Services/Other. The company offers demand deposit accounts, savings accounts, and money market savings accounts. Meta Financial Group Inc (CASH) - Net Assets

Latest net assets as of December 2025: $853.71 Million USD

Based on the latest financial reports, Meta Financial Group Inc (CASH) has net assets worth $853.71 Million USD as of December 2025.

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ets ($7.56 Billion) and total liabilities ($6.71 Billion).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off.

Equity Growth Attribution

This analysis shows how different factors contributed to changes in Meta Financial Group Inc's equity between the two most recent reporting periods.

Equity Growth Insights

  • From 2024 to 2025, total equity changed from 839,882,000 to 858,045,000, a change of 18,163,000 (2.2%).
  • Net income of 185,872,000 contributed positively to equity growth.
  • Dividend payments of 4,686,000 reduced retained earnings.
  • Share repurchases of 163,047,000 reduced equity.
  • Other comprehensive income increased equity by 7,933,000.
